Manufacturing Corporate Controller
Location: Los Angeles, CA (Hybrid)
Employment Type: Exempt, Full-Time, Direct-Hire
Overview:
A dynamic and well-established global manufacturer is seeking a Corporate Controller to oversee its accounting operations and financial management functions. The ideal candidate will be a CPA with extensive experience in manufacturing accounting, including cost accounting, audit preparation, J-SOX compliance, ERP systems, and team leadership.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ities including but are not limited to:
Manage and supervise all aspects of corporate accounting, including AR, AP, general ledger, cost accounting, and budgeting.
Lead the financial close process in collaboration with the internal finance team and external CPA firm.
Develop, maintain, and implement accounting policies and procedures.
Develop and enforce internal control frameworks aligned with J-SOX standards.
Prepare for external audits and ensure timely audit completion.
Oversee all tax-related filings, including income, payroll, and sales/use taxes.
Conduct annual pricing and cost reviews in partnership with relevant departments.
Drive enhancements and upgrades of ERP and accounting systems in partnership with external consultants.
Lead system improvement upgrades and accounting technology initiatives.
Coordinate annual inventory audits with external auditors.
Streamline and accelerate the monthly close process, with a target of reducing the cycle.
Act as a key liaison between Finance, Operations, Sales, and IT to support broader business goals.
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field
CPA certification is required
10+ years of progressive accounting experience, including 5+ years in a senior-level leadership role
Strong accounting background in a manufacturing setting, including cost accounting
Hands-on experience with J-SOX compliance and internal controls
Proficiency with ERP/accounting systems
Strong understanding of GAAP, financial reporting, and internal controls
Exceptional communication, leadership, and team development skills
Ability to thrive in a fast-paced and evolving business environment
